- **Event Description**: Explore Everglades National Park with Homestead's free trolley departing from Downtown Homestead.About this EventHomestead invites its residents, neighbors, and visitors to explore Everglades and Biscayne National Parks, and Homestead Bayfront Park with a free guided trolley ride from Downtown Homestead. The Special Holiday service returns everyday from December 26 - 31, 2026 and the regular season trolley will take place EVERY WEEKEND from January 3-April 5th, 2026.Catch the National Parks Trolley, every Saturday and Sunday, at Homestead Station in Downtown Homestead, 4 South Krome Avenue, Homestead, FL 33030. Hotel guests can also catch the Trolley at the Courtyard by Marriott on Campbell Drive at 2905 NE 9th Street, Homestead, FL 33033.Guided ToursLearn about the unique ecosystems and rich history of Homestead and the National Parks on guided tours provided on the trolley by National Park Rangers and Volunteers.Plan Your TripStart and end your experience in Downtown Homestead. Eat at great local restaurants! Tour Homestead's FREE Old Town Hall Museum or catch a show at the newly restored Seminole Theatre. Enjoy a walk through a town full of history, distinct architecture, and new opportunities. We encourage you to make a weekend of it! Stay at local hotels and take the whole family to one Park on Saturday and the other Park on Sunday.Public TransportationIf want to get to the Homestead National Parks Trolley stop by using Miami-Dade County Public Transportation use the Miami-Dade Transit Trip Planner at MiamiDade.gov for a step-by-step guide on catching bus 38 to the Trolley stop at Homestead Station, located at 4 S. Krome Avenue.Trip RoutesDowntown Homestead to Everglades National Park9:00am | 11:04am | 2:08pm | 4:12pmNote: The last trolley trip is one-way only.Marriott Hotel to Everglades National Park via Downtown Homestead(Transfer Required) 10:17am | 11:53am | 1:39pm (Reserve the next later departure from Downtown Homestead - listed above)Anhinga Trail to Downtown Homestead*10:09am | 12:13pm | 3:17pm | 5:01pm*Includes 20-minute stop at Robert is Here Fruit StandAnhinga Trail to Marriott Hotel via Downtown Homestead*(Transfer Required) 10:09am | 12:13pm | 3:17pm*Includes 20-minute stop at Robert is Here Fruit StandTips for a Smooth Trolley Experience1. Choose One Park Per DayWe do not recommend visiting both parks in a single day. Each park offers a full day of activities, trails, and experiences. Pick a park, pack a picnic, and enjoy the day at your own pace.2. Check Return Times at Your Drop-Off LocationWhen the trolley drops you off, look for the posted return schedule sign at that stop.Please make sure you meet the last return time listed—this is the only way to get back to Downtown Homestead using the trolley.3. The Trolley Is Transportation, Not a Tour BusThe trolley provides transportation to and from the parks, not continuous guided touring.If you board the last departure from Downtown at 4:12 PM or 4:34 PM, you will not have time to explore the park before the final return trip. In this situation, you must:Find your own transportation back to Downtown ORStay on the trolley for its complete route without disembarkingPlan ahead to make the most of your visit!
